Q: Who plays Brianna in "Grace and Frankie"? I love that show, and I love her in it.

Author: 
Adam Thomlison / TV Media

Grace's daughter Brianna in "Grace and Frankie" is played by longtime sketch comedy star June Diane Raphael. Being a female comic making a successful transition from sketch to sitcom puts her on a path blazed partly by her "Grace and Frankie" co-star, the great Lily Tomlin. Tomlin became famous as a cast member in the sketch comedy classic "Laugh-In" in the late '60s and early '70s.

New Releases for the week of September 17-23

Wonder Woman

On the hidden island of Themyscira live the Amazons, a group of warrior women created by Zeus to protect humanity. When an aircraft crashes off the island's coast, young Amazonian princess Diana (Gadot) rescues its pilot, the dashing American Steve Trevor (Pine), who tells the Amazons of World War I raging just outside of their protected sphere. Convinced that it is her destiny to stop the fighting, and that Ares, the god of war, is behind the conflict, Diana leaves her people and her home behind to venture to the front lines, where she discovers truths not only about herself but also about the true nature of humanity.

Director: Patty Jenkins. Stars: Gal Gadot, Chris Pine, Connie Nielsen, Robin Wright, Danny Huston, David Thewlis, Saïd Taghmaoui, Ewen Bremner, Eugene Brave Rock, Elena Anaya. 2017. 141 min. Action.

 

The Big Sick

Kumail (Nanjiani) is a Pakistani-American comedian who works as an Uber driver in his spare time. His traditional parents are determined to arrange a marriage for him, but after he meets Emily (Kazan) at one of his shows, he finds himself growing closer and closer to her. Shortly after they have an explosive argument that leads to their breakup, Emily is taken to the hospital with a serious infection and Kumail rushes to her side, where he meets her parents and bonds with her father (Romano).

Director: Michael Showalter. Stars: Kumail Nanjiani, Zoe Kazan, Holly Hunter, Ray Romano, Anupam Kher, Zenobia Schroff. 2017. 120 min. Comedy.

 

The Bad Batch

Arlen (Waterhouse) is placed inside a vast fenced-off area just outside of Texas that is outside of the realm of laws and government. Shortly after her arrival, she is attacked and taken prisoner by a group of cannibals, from whom she manages to escape while keeping most of her body intact. Elsewhere in the desert wilderness, she is taken in by a secure town called Comfort, which is ruled by a cult-like leader named The Dream (Reeves), who maintains control over his people using drugs.

Director: Ana Lily Amirpour. Stars: Suki Waterhouse, Jason Momoa, Jayda Fink, Keanu Reeves, Jim Carrey, Diego Luna, Yolonda Ross. 2016. 118 min. Romance.
